Enum BorrowStateV2 

Source
pub enum BorrowStateV2 {
    Owned,
    SharedRef {
        source: VarId,
        start_line: u32,
    },
    MutRef {
        source: VarId,
        start_line: u32,
    },
    Moved {
        to: VarId,
        at_line: u32,
    },
    Dropped {
        at_line: u32,
    },
    Copied {
        to: VarId,
        at_line: u32,
    },
}
Expand description

The ownership/borrow state of a variable (V2 - uses VarId).

Variants§

§

Owned

Variable owns its value (T).

§

SharedRef

Variable is a shared reference (&T).

Fields

§source: VarId

The variable being borrowed from.

§start_line: u32

Line where the borrow started.

§

MutRef

Variable is a mutable reference (&mut T).

Fields

§source: VarId

The variable being borrowed from.

§start_line: u32

Line where the borrow started.

§

Moved

Ownership has been moved to another variable.

Fields

§to: VarId

The variable that now owns the value.

§at_line: u32

Line where the move occurred.

§

Dropped

Variable has been dropped (out of scope).

Fields

§at_line: u32

Line where the drop occurred.

§

Copied

Copy semantics - value was copied, original still valid.

Fields

§to: VarId

The variable that received the copy.

§at_line: u32

Line where the copy occurred.

Implementations§

Source§

impl BorrowStateV2

Source

pub fn can_read(&self) -> bool

Check if the variable can be used (read).

Source

pub fn can_mutate(&self) -> bool

Check if the variable can be mutated.

Source

pub fn is_invalidated(&self) -> bool

Check if the variable has been invalidated (moved or dropped).

Source

pub fn is_reference(&self) -> bool

Check if this is a reference (shared or mutable).

Source

pub fn borrow_source(&self) -> Option<VarId>

Get the source variable if this is a reference.
